The Descent of Mainstream Cryptocurrency Metrics
The ETF Withdrawal Impact
Exchange-Traded Funds (ETFs) have historically functioned as a cornerstone for infusing capital into the cryptocurrency ecosystem. Yet, their performance has recently taken a turn for the worse, characterized by significant outflows that began in mid-October. This was exacerbated further by macroeconomic tensions and the rapid interest rate fluctuations anticipated for December. For context, ETFs began experiencing multiple consecutive weeks of net outflows amounting to a staggering $4.9 billion, the most substantial since April 2025.
This level of withdrawal indicates a cooling sentiment among institutional investors who are often the primary participants in these funds. The massive sell-off during October’s so-called “Uptober” – a historically bullish month – further decelerated ETFs’ capability to absorb Bitcoin’s supply, causing a ripple effect across the market.
DATs Feeling the Pressure
Parallel to the ETF’s struggles, Digital Asset Treasuries (DATs), which often operate analogously to corporate treasuries, are also undergoing strain. With the retreat in Bitcoin pricing and consequentially in DAT company stock values, their once vigorous growth engines found themselves overwrought.
Particularly, DAT heavyweights like Strategy, with its considerable holdings of Bitcoin constituting 3.2% of the current total supply, are demonstrating slower upticks in asset acquisition as their net asset value gets slapped with compression pressures. This market condition leads to tighter financing opportunities through debt or equity channels, hampering their potential to amass further holdings.

Macroeconomic and Internal Crypto Dynamics at Play
Shift to Safe Havens
In the broader economic theater, Bitcoin finds its lustre diminished when juxtaposed against traditional safe-haven assets like gold, which garnered over 50% in returns thus far, while tech stocks stumbled. Central banks stockpiling gold amidst rising trade tensions make gold an attractive bet, whereas Bitcoin’s allure as a risk-on asset stalls alongside the Nasdaq.
Bitcoin’s sensitivity to market shocks or ‘catalytic’ incidents – such as the momentous flash crash on October 11th – further highlights its current vulnerability within the market ecosystem. The technical linkage that once held Bitcoin in linearity with tech stocks appears weakened amidst corrective forces.
Deleveraging and Liquidity Conundrums
The Deleveraging Phenomenon
Cryptocurrency faced an unprecedented deleveraging event post the October crash, with perpetual futures and DeFi lending markets bearing the brunt. This prompted a remarkable return to basics with reduced systemic risk exposure. Several exchanges like Binance and Bybit saw their open interest sliced by over 30%, withdrawing hyper-leveraged positions that inflated the marketplace beyond comfort.
Notably, the funding rates have hovered between neutral and slightly negative, indicating a recalibration of trading sentiment. This deleveraging is not restricted to futures; decentralized finance (DeFi) platforms too saw notable reversals in sentiment. Aave V3, for instance, reported a consistent fallback in active loan scales post an ethylene decoupling.
Liquidity under Strain
The aftermath of October 11th left liquidity on shaky ground, stymied by low trade volumes. Major c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ether have yet to see trading depth recover to pre-crash levels, recording a decline of 30-40%. Trading environments remain fickle, with significant price shifts observable upon even moderate trade activities, further complicating the prospect of a stable price floor. In particular, altcoins suffer more severely from liquidity issues than their major counterparts, revealing a glaring underbelly exposed to speculative risk aversion.
